“How do you know if your ECG is abnormal?”
I am a 42 year old male. I wonder how can I know if my ECG is abnormal?
1 Answer
Most ECGs are initially interpreted by the computer, which gives a preliminary reading. The final reading is by a cardiologist, or other physician who is credentialed to interpret these studies. The reading will usually clearly state “normal,” “borderline,” or “abnormal,” and the abnormal finding will be in the report.
